Missionary Update: Robert & Cirena Smith
Post Date: 2010-09-15 13:44:17

Dear Family & Friends,

It?s been one year now since we have returned to the Philippines and though challenging at times, overall it has been an incredible blessing.? We are truly grateful for all of you that pray faithfully for us, for those of you that give of your finances as you are able (especially in difficult economic times), and just for the overall encouragement we receive from many of you in one form or another.

Now on to more exciting news.? Recently I (Smitty) had the privilege of re-visiting the southern Isnag in northern Luzon. Text Box:    Smitty hiking with southern Isnag men.Since we are currently without a flight program in Luzon this involved an all day hike in both directions.? To learn more about this trip and what God has been teaching me read: Re-visiting the Southern Isnag & check out the new photos on our blog.? God is doing some exciting things and we are blessed to be a part of it as I hope you are too.? Please be in prayer for me as I find more and more opportunities to serve within the local church at MBCC ?(Man. Bible Christian Church) which includes leading a small group men?s discipleship class, organizing fellowship and outreach opportunities as well as providing occasional pulpit supply.? Praise God for how all of this has enhanced culture and language learning but more importantly for the relationships being developed.

Text Box:    Cirena with MBCC ladies in Tagaytay.Cirena is doing well & she too is excited about the local church that the Lord has given us to minister & serve alongside of.? Cirena has been very active in women?s ministry, teaching a small group ladies discipleship class and also organizing fellowship events (& quite frankly doing a better job of it than I).? Recently the ladies had an excellent day trip for fellowship to Tagaytay, a beautiful mountain setting about 1 ? hours outside of the city.? For FACEBOOK users, check out the pics she posted on her account.? She is also a regular teacher in the Children?s Sunday School program.? Praise God for how she is being used here.
